This week, I decided to use two black and white photos of my daughter when she was still a college student.  I love the way black and white photos look against purple or blue.  The grey tones just really go well with those two colors, and I love the look.

I used the All Postal set again (I love that set!) from Mark’s Finest Paper.  It’s just super versatile and I find myself reaching for it a lot.  This time, I used it to make a faux postcard.  It has the stamp, a postmark…all kinds of cute images and sentiments.  My base cardstock is from Kay & Co. and the rest of it is just solid stuff from my stash.  The row of bling is from Hobby Lobby.  I used a the “4 page layout” cut file from the Silhouette store for most of the cuts.
